Enjoy an afternoon of laughter at the cinema: we present Buster Keaton’s masterful comedy Steamboat Bill, Jr (1928), preceded by his iconic & innovative short film One Week (1920). The films will be accompanied by a live piano soundtrack by Kingston’s own improvisational genius Spencer Evans!

Book Launch: Author & Podcaster Ryan Barnett will be in attendance to introduce the films & sign copies of his new graphic novel: Buster Keaton: A Life in Pictures (available for purchase before & after the film).

Ryan Barnett is a Porkpie Scholar and host of the podcast series Once Upon a Time in Hollywood North. He lives in Montreal with his partner and daughter.
